Effect of prokinetic agents on ileal contractility in a rabbit model of gastroschisis.

Abstract

Intestinal hypomotility is a major problem after repair of gastroschisis. The authors assessed the effect of four clinically available prokinetic agents on intestinal contractility using a rabbit model of gastroschisis. Gastroschisis was surgically created at 24 days' gestation in fetal rabbits. At term, 10-mm ileal muscle strips were harvested, suspended in an organ bath, and stimulated with 10(-6) mol/L carbechol with and without each prokinetic agent: metoclopromide (1 x 10(-5) mol/L), cisapride (2 x 10(-5) mol/L), erythromycin (1 x 10(-5) mol/L), and octreotide (5 x 10(-5) mol/L). The effect of each agent on contractility was calculated as percent change from maximal response to carbechol alone. There were two control groups: sham operated fetuses, and maternal ileum. Metoclopromide was effective only in the adult rabbits. Cisapride improved contractility in newborns with gastroschisis, as well as in both newborn and adult control groups. Neither erythromycin or octreotide improved bethanechol-induced contractility in any of the animals. These data suggest that cisapride may be useful for treating hypoperistalsis in infants with gastroschisis. Clinical studies must be done to further pursue this finding.

摘要

腹裂修补术后肠道动力不足是一个主要问题。作者使用兔腹裂模型评估了四种临床可用促动力药物对肠道收缩性的影响。在孕24天时通过手术在胎兔身上制造腹裂。足月时,采集10毫米的回肠肌条,悬挂于器官浴槽中,并用10(-6)摩尔/升的卡巴胆碱刺激,同时加入或不加入每种促动力药物:胃复安(1×10(-5)摩尔/升)、西沙必利(2×10(-5)摩尔/升)、红霉素(1×10(-5)摩尔/升)和奥曲肽(5×10(-5)摩尔/升)。每种药物对收缩性的影响计算为相对于单独使用卡巴胆碱的最大反应的变化百分比。有两个对照组:假手术胎儿组和母体回肠组。胃复安仅在成年兔中有效。西沙必利可改善腹裂新生儿以及新生儿和成年对照组的收缩性。红霉素和奥曲肽均未改善任何动物中氨甲酰甲胆碱诱导的收缩性。这些数据表明西沙必利可能对治疗腹裂婴儿的蠕动不足有用。必须进行临床研究以进一步探究这一发现。
